competitive

adj.
1.involving competition or competitiveness
2.subscribing to capitalistic competition
3.showing a fighting disposition without self-seeking

  • Idiom of the Day

    stick to one's ribs
    to last a long time and give one strength (used for food)
    The food at the restaurant is wonderful and it sticks to our ribs.
